Tom Rondeau wrote:
Just the status report from the work done the past couple of weeks on
OFDM. With Matt Ettus, Bob McGwier, and Eric Blossom, we successfully
transmitted and received OFDM over the air with BPSK, QPSK, and 16QAM. I
have merged the code into the trunk so others can use it, though I
currently restricted the subcarrier modulations to use only BPSK or QPSK
(M-QAM will be coming soon I hope). It's not complete; specificially, it
lacks an adaptive equalizer over the entire packet and channel coding.
Other features should be coming over time, too.
